Poland 2050 sends compromise crypto bill to president after veto, awaits response
After President Karol Nawrocki vetoed the government's cryptoasset law, coalition partner Polska 2050 negotiated amendments directly with the Presidential Chancellery and submitted a revised version.

Sejm marshal kills Polish president's judiciary bill after Venice Commission finds it threatens rule of law
Sejm Marshal Włodzimierz Czarzasty refused to advance a presidential judiciary draft on 17 June 2026, citing a Venice Commission opinion that called the bill a threat to judicial independence and unable to resolve Poland's rule-of-law impasse.
